  • Mr White - Verified booking

    "The Lookout" at Sennen Cove has a number of desirable features. It is located very close to the harbour and beach (even if the 76 steps up to it can be demanding), and also to the coast path. It has fantastic views of the sea from three large windows. The flat has a contemporary, coastal feel and is light and airy. The extra-large bed is comfortable. The bathroom has an excellent shower, and the one-person bath in the bedroom is a lovely addition, especially given the view from it. There is plenty of hot water and good water pressure throughout the flat. The kitchen includes a full-size cooker and oven, 'fridge, and microwave, and while there isn't much preparation space, it will probably work well enough for most. There is also a washing machine (which we didn't use). Sadly, the flat isn't particularly well looked after. The cleaning in particular was poor in places. While the obvious things were clean enough (sink, bath, shower, etc.), we were bothered by the following: (1) We had to clean dusty cobwebs and spiders off the walls and ceilings in the bedroom. It was clear that no one had done this for weeks. (2) There were what looked like animal hairs on the bed cover when we arrived. (3) There was a dirty single mattress underneath the bed, as well as a mattress protector and sheet. (4) The floor throughout the flat had not been mopped for some time and was sticky. (5) There was black mold on all the window frames. It looked like someone had possibly run a cloth over some of it, but little more than that. We found that a substantial amount came off with just a cursory wipe, suggesting that no one had made any real effort to clean them in a long time. Some of the walls around the windows also needed to have mold removed and to be repainted. (6) The blinds were dirty and needed washing or replacing. (7) The windows were dirty and needed to be cleaned on the inside and the outside. (8) The 'fridge was so noisy that it could be heard in the bedroom with the door closed. Given that it only just about managed to keep items cold when on its coldest setting (and that in cool-ish weather), it presumably needed repair. Our milk went off after two days of being in there, strangely. (9) The sliding bedroom door only opened about three quarters of the way because of how it had been hung. (10) The windows, which are one the flat's main attractions, open inwards, but couldn't be opened more than a few inches because of the blinds. (11) The telescope didn't work, despite following he instructions; my best guess is that a power cable was missing. We drew this to Original Cottages' attention the day after we arrived using the e-mail address specified for support during stays, but heard nothing back. If the issues above were addressed, we would be happy to recommend this flat without reservation and probably to book it again ourselves.
